Content Checked Holdings, Inc. (CNCK) Providing Mobile Solution to Navigating Potentially Dangerous Food Allergies

Content Checked Holdings, Inc. (OTCQB: CNCK) caters to the underserved marketplace for people with dietary restrictions and its associated organizations through the continued development and commercialization of the ContentChecked, MigraineChecked and SugarChecked smartphone applications. The company’s innovative apps, which are currently available on both Google Play and the Apple App Store, allow users to scan food products for food allergens and other unwanted ingredients and provides recommendations of alternative products and recipes that fit within the user’s dietary preferences.

“Born from a father’s confusion and frustration about what to feed his daughter and her friends with specific food allergies, Content Checked was founded to design and develop solutions that will positively impact individuals’ health,” Kris Finstad, chief executive officer of Content Checked, stated in a news release. “[W]e see ContentChecked as being a critical tool to newly diagnosed food allergy families just learning to read labels and finding safe foods.”

In recent years, the prevalence of potentially life-threatening food allergies has rapidly increased. According to data from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, the occurrence of food allergies and associated anaphylaxis increased by 18 percent between 1997 and 2007. Today, an estimated 12 million Americans suffer from food allergies, including eight percent of all children, based on a study by the Food Allergy Initiative. For Content Checked, these statistics highlight the potentially massive market appeal of its groundbreaking suite of apps moving forward.

Since being founded in 2013, Content Checked has developed a robust database of allergens, migraine triggers and food ingredients that directly correlate with food allergies or other potential health concerns, which forms the basis of its proprietary apps. This database currently features hundreds of thousands of products, and its highly scalable design will allow the company to expand its services into potentially lucrative markets around the country with limited modifications and investment.
